Overview of the 2008 SCION TC

The 2008 SCION TC has received a total of 109 safety complaints filed with the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A). There have been 3 recall campaigns affecting this vehicle, covering issues with EQUIPMENT:OTHER:LABELS. 12 technical service bulletins have been issued by Toyota Motor Corporation for this model year. The most commonly reported problems involve the Engine (23 complaints), Structurebody (11 complaints), and Air Bags (9 complaints).

Recalls for the 2008 SCION TC

NHTSA has recorded 3 recalls for the 2008 SCION TC, potentially affecting up to 451,915 vehicles.

Recall 10V036000 — EQUIPMENT:OTHER:LABELS

| 153,418 vehicles affected

Defect: SOUTHEAST TOYOTA IS RECALLING CERTAIN MODEL YEAR 2005-2011 PASSENGER VEHICLES FOR FAILING TO COMPLY WITH THE REQUIREMENTS OF FEDERAL MOTOR VEHICLE SAFETY STANDARD NO. 110, "TIRE SELECTION AND RIMS." THESE VEHICLES WERE SOLD WITHOUT THE REQUISITE LOAD CARRYING CAPACITY MODIFICATION LABELS.

Consequence: A DRIVER MAY OVERLOAD A VEHICLE WHICH MAY INCREASE THE RISK OF A CRASH.

Remedy: DEALERS WILL MAIL TO CONSUMERS THE CORRECTED LABEL OR THE CUSTOMER WILL HAVE THE OPTION FOR DEALERS TO INSTALL THE LABEL FREE OF CHARGE. THE SAFETY RECALL BEGAN ON MAY 27, 2010. OWNERS MAY CONTACT SOUTHEAST TOYOTA AT 1-800-301-6859.

Recall 09V223000 — EQUIPMENT:OTHER:LABELS

| 27,080 vehicles affected

Defect: TOYOTA IS RECALLING 27,080 MODEL YEAR 2005 THROUGH 2010 PASSENGER CARS BUILT FROM SEPTEMBER 1, 2005 TO MAY 4, 2009. THESE VEHICLES WERE NOT EQUIPPED WITH LOAD CARRYING CAPACITY MODIFICATION LABELS WHICH FAILS TO CONFORM WITH THE REQUIREMENTS OF FEDERAL MOTOR VEHICLE SAFETY STANDARD NO. 110, "TIRE SELECTION AND RIMS."

Consequence: INCORRECT LOAD CARRYING CAPACITY MODIFICATION LABELS COULD RESULT IN THE VEHICLE BEING OVERLOADED, INCREASING THE RISK OF A CRASH.

Remedy: TOYOTA WILL NOTIFY OWNERS AND PROVIDE THEM WITH A NEW, ACCURATE LABEL TO BE INSTALLED OVER THE INACCURATE LABEL FREE OF CHARGE. THE SAFETY RECALL BEGAN ON AUGUST 18, 2009. OWNERS MAY CONTACT TOYOTA AT 1-888-270-9371.

#11217977 | ENGINE | | 94,000 miles
ENGINE CONSUMES TOO MUCH OIL . HAVE TO REFILL THE OIL IN MY ENGINE ABOUT TWO TIMES IN BETWEEN OIL CHANGES.
#11191640 | FUEL/PROPULSION SYSTEM | | 100,000 miles
2008 - SCION - TOYOTA - BURNING OIL, BURNING A QUART OF OIL IN LESS THAN EVERY 800 MILES. CAR IS UP TO DATE WITH ALL MAINTENANCE. MECHANIC REFERRED US TO DEALERSHIP. TOYOTA ISSUED A TSB - 'SOME 2006 ' 2011 MODEL YEAR VEHICLES EQUIPPED WITH THE 2AZ-FE ENGINE MAY EXHIBIT ENGINE OIL CONSUMPTION. THE PISTON ASSEMBLY HAS BEEN CHANGED TO MINIMIZE OIL CONSUMPTION.' AND THAT 'P030# (CYLINDER # MISFIRE DETECTED) DTC MAY ALSO BE SET AS A RESULT OF OIL CONSUMPTION.' HOWEVER DEALERSHIP REFUSES TO EVEN TEST OR REPAIR THE VEHICLE. SAYING WE ONLY HAD UNTIL AUG 2017. WE WERE NEVER NOTIFIED OF SUCH ISSUES, NO LETTERS OR ANYTHING WERE SENT TO US. CAR HAS ALWAYS BEEN REGISTERED AND OUR OWNER INFO HAS ALWAYS BEEN AVAILABLE TO TOYOTA. SO NOW WE ARE STUCK WITH DEFECTIVE VEHICLE.

Technical Service Bulletins for the 2008 SCION TC

Toyota Motor Corporation has issued 12 technical service bulletins (TSBs) for the 2008 SCION TC. TSBs are notices sent by manufacturers to their dealers describing a known issue and the recommended repair procedure.

S-TT-0099-15 — 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ING

TT: * There has been some concern with 3 Piece Piston Ring installations for 2AZ-FE engines. * This Tech Tip contains the accepted installation method required for Scion vehicles.

ZE7_WEP_Customer — EQUIPMENT:OTHER:OWNERS/SERVICE/OTHER MANUAL

DD: Toyota has updated the Customer Handling Reference Guide to include the expansion vehicles; please refer to TIS for the most current version. All previous versions of this document should be discarded. Please review this guide along with the previously provided FAQ to respond to customer inquiries. Laminated hard copies...

ZE7_WEP_Warranty — ENGINE

WPB: Toyota has received some reports where vehicles may exhibit excessive engine oil consumption. This Warranty Enhancement Program will be launched in two phases due to current part production capacity limitations. Initially, Toyota will inform owners that they may seek reimbursement consideration for previous repairs to address excessive oil consumption....
